    Hi all, Trying to rip a DVD (my first) to my hard drive using DVD decrypter. When I first launch the program I get the error "media region code mismatched to logical unit region"
    I have tried un-installing and re-installing the program and researching this error on the web. I found a couple of threads on the subject but none of them give a definitive answer to the problem. I use a P4 2.8C (HT) 1Gb Corsair DDR, 2x80Gb and 1x200Gb Hard drives and Windows XP pro (NTFS) - oh and my burner is an optorite DD0203 (with latest firmware update)

    Any ideas?

    ignore error, all it will say is that it will have to use a different method and use brute force,click on and carry on....happens everytime you use region that is different to your drive......

    RPC 1 updates are usually free Firmware hacks to enable multi-region playing. You should check the last few minutes of the DVD to make sure it has burnt correctly since the error was 97% through.
